Job Description Key Responsibilities: 1. Guest Experience & Hosting Welcome clients and guests with warmth, professionalism, and natural elegance, ensuring each interaction reflects the AP values of authenticity and respect. Curate a home-like environment that balances discretion and conviviality — offering coffee, drinks, or culinary moments that make guests feel truly cared for. Coordinate private appointments, events, and bespoke hospitality experiences Anticipate guest needs, personalize experiences, and create emotional connections that inspire long-term relationships. 2. Atmosphere & Ambience Management Ensure the AP House embodies our distinctive lifestyle — refined yet relaxed — through attention to music, scent, decoration, and overall atmosphere. Oversee the maintenance of hospitality areas, ensuring impeccable presentation and alignment with brand aesthetics. Collaborate with internal and external partners (catering, florists, maintenance, etc.) to uphold a seamless experience environment. 3. Beverage & Bar Management Supervise and support the bartender to ensure client service that aligns with the brand standard Curate and refresh the beverage menu, including coffee, tea, and cocktail selections, to reflect seasonal inspirations and guest preferences. Oversee bar inventory, supplies, and presentation standards. Ensure all beverage service complies with health, safety, and brand hospitality guidelines 4. Collaboration & Team Support Work closely with the boutique team to align hospitality actions with client engagement strategies. Support retail and marketing teams during client events, dinners, or private gatherings. Share insights and feedback to continuously refine the client experience within the House.
